nodal myocyte CL_0002072 [A specialized cardiac myocyte in the sinoatrial and atrioventricular nodes. The cell is slender and fusiform confined to the nodal center, circumferentially arranged around the nodal artery.]
skeletal muscle hypertrophy GO_0014734 [The enlargement or overgrowth of all or part of an organ due to an increase in size (not length) of individual muscle fibers without cell division. In the case of skeletal muscle cells this happens due to the additional synthesis of sarcomeric proteins and assembly of myofibrils.]
skeletal muscle adaptation GO_0043501 [Any process in which skeletal muscles change their phenotypic profiles in response to altered functional demands and a variety of signals.]
vascular associated smooth muscle cell development GO_0097084 [The process aimed at the progression of a vascular smooth muscle cell over time, from initial commitment of the cell to a specific fate, to the fully functional differentiated cell. A vascular smooth muscle cell is a non-striated, elongated, spindle-shaped cell found lining the blood vessels.]
muscle cell development GO_0055001 [The process whose specific outcome is the progression of a muscle cell over time, from its formation to the mature structure. Muscle cell development does not include the steps involved in committing an unspecified cell to the muscle cell fate.]
perichondral bone UBERON_0008913 [Bone element that is located on the surface of a cartilage element.]
membrane bone UBERON_0007842 [Bone element that arises as a result of intramembranous ossification.]
chondral bone UBERON_0008911 [Replacement bone that forms within or surrounding a cartilaginous skeletal element.]
replacement bone UBERON_0012075 [Bone that forms as a replacement of another structural tissue.]
perichordal bone UBERON_0008909 [Bone element that is adjacent to the notochord.]
sublaminar layer S5 UBERON_0008926 [A retinal neural layer that is immediately adjacent to the retinal ganglion cell layer and comprises 20 percent of the ganglion plexiform layer of retina.]
sublaminar layers S4 or S5 UBERON_0008929 [One of sublaminar layers S4 or S5.]
sublaminar layer S4 UBERON_0008925 [A retinal neural layer that is immediately adjacent to the S3 and S5 layer and comprises 20 percent of the inner plexiform layer of retina.]
sublaminar layer S3 UBERON_0008924 [A retinal neural layer that is immediately adjacent to the S2 and S4 layers and comprises 20 percent of the inner plexiform layer of retina.]
sublaminar layers S2 or S3 UBERON_0008928 [One of sublaminar layers S2 or S3.]
sublaminar layer S2 UBERON_0008923 [A retinal neural layer that is immediately adjacent to the S1 and S3 layers and comprises 20 percent of the inner plexiform layer of retina.]
sublaminar layers S1 or S2 UBERON_0008927 [One of sublaminar layers S1 or S2.]
sublaminar layer S1 UBERON_0008922 [A retinal neural layer that is immediately adjacent to the inner nuclear layer and comprises 20 percent of the inner plexiform layer of retina.]
